Valencia – Espanyol: 15th January 2017

Valencia is currently lies in 17th position in the ranking Primera Division with 13 points accumulated after 16 matches of the championship.
The hosts are in a continuous drop shape. After the championship draw 3-3 with Osasuna, “bats” have given the land of Celta Vigo on in the Spanish Cup, 2-1.
Spaniard Rodrigo is the team’s top scorer in the league, he has 4 goals scored, so far.
Eliaquim Mangala is suspended, while Aymen Abdennour is left for the African Cup.

Probable team Valencia: Alves – Gaya, Santos Suarez Montoya – Perez Soler Parejo – Nani, Munir, Rodrigo.

On the other side, Espanyol ranks 11th of the league the first leagues in Spain, the team managed to collect 23 points in 17 stages.
Guests undergoing a difficult enough. After being eliminated by Alcorcon in the Spanish Cup, they won only a draw in the championship, 1-1 with Deportivo La Coruna ones.
Spaniard G. Moreno is the best scorer of the team in Primera Division with 7 goals scored by each, in 17 matches of the championship.
Guests can not rely on Papakouly Diop (left Africa Cup), Leo Baptistao and Javi Lopez (both injured).

Espanyol Probable team: Lopez – Sanchez, Lopez, Reyes, Caricol – Perez Jurado, Fuego, Sevilla – Moreno Vazquez
